Introduction: Water is the basic need of human beings and there is no substitute for water. This research was conducted to analyze public willingness to use water from filtration plants installed by public own Organizations and which psychological factors may help them to decide to use safe water.Entities:

Path Analysis (PLS-SEM)
| Statistical Paths | Beta (β) | Std. Dev | Hypothesis |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| WQK -> WUFWFP | 0.342 | 0.033 | 10.392 | 0.000 | Accepted |
| SP -> WUFWFP | 0.125 | 0.028 | 4.515 | 0.000 | Accepted |
| HC -> WUFWFP | 0.488 | 0.038 | 12.859 | 0.000 | Accepted |
| HW -> WUFWFP | 0.160 | 0.038 | 4.213 | 0.000 | Accepted |
| CS -> WUFWFP | −0.114 | 0.033 | 3.434 | 0.001 | Accepted |
| WC-> WUFWFP | −0.054 | 0.025 | 2.130 | 0.033 | Accepted |
| Edu -> WUFWFP | 0.009 | 0.010 | 0.454 | 0.650 | Insignificant |
| Gender -> WUFWFP | 0.004 | 0.020 | 0.209 | 0.834 | Insignificant |
| R2 | 0.788 | ||||
| Adjusted R2 | 0.785 | ||||
| Q2 | 0.619 | ||||
